  • Virtual Learning: Bridging the Distance

    Funded Sep 17, 2020

    First of all I must say thank you again for your generosity! This school year has been unlike any other. In the almost 20 years that I have been teaching I never thought we would have a school year like this. A year ago I did not even know what Zoom was and now it is used every school day to connect with students that have remained home during this pandemic and are attending school virtually. When the school year started off all students and teachers were still home and Zooming. Even though I have a school issued laptop the screen is very small. It is near impossible to Zoom while attempting to view the students' faces and screen share any instructional material simultaneously. Through this Donors Choose project and your generosity you made it possible for me to utilize the existing monitor in my home office along with this second monitor and webcam. I am now able to run Zoom on one monitor and have instructional materials on the second monitor. This was so beneficial for the first month and half of the school year that we were still home. Shortly after returning physically to school in October I was then sent home to quarantine for two weeks. During those two weeks I worked from home and the monitor and webcam were indispensable again to have class with my virtual students. I have now taken the second monitor and webcam to school to use with my desktop computer there as there are still classes that I Zoom daily with. Again, a million thanks for bringing this project to a reality and making teaching a little bit easier during this school year like no other!”

  • iPad and Osmo for Fun Learning Success!

    Funded Sep 12, 2015

    Technology is a necessity in the classroom and the iPad (with its protective Otterbox case) and the Osmo has been a great addition to the classroom. The Osmo along with the iPad has been implemented as one of the centers during small group rotation during math class. The students are so excited when it is their assigned day to use the iPad and Osmo. One of the activities on the Osmo is tangrams. The students have to apply critical thinking skills when solving the tangram puzzles. I love seeing the expressions on their faces as they try to work out the puzzles. I know that the "wheels" in their heads are turning!”

My students are second graders at a public magnet school located in south Florida. The focus of our magnet curriculum is international education along with foreign languages. Each grade level focuses on a different part of the world and studies the geography, cultures, traditions, holidays, history, etc. of that part of the world. In addition to that, every student in the school is instructed for at least an hour daily in either Spanish or French. My students are passionate about learning, and like to get involved in hands-on activities. Through hands on activities, whether they be projects, experiments, or games, the students are learning while having fun at the same time. Often that is the best way to learn!
